Leeds is a city in transformation, with extensive redevelopment and a diverse economy making it a Northern Powerhouse hotspot.
The regeneration of the city’s South Bank area is being promoted as the biggest change Leeds has seen in more than 100 years.
One of the largest projects of its kind in Europe and covering a huge swathe of land on the southern edge of the River Aire, the ambitious scheme aims to effectively double the size of the city centre.
We are involved in a number of developments planned for the area, including as principal contractor on Mustard Wharf, a private rented sector scheme for Legal and General.
Under construction alongside the Leeds and Liverpool Canal, the project will provide a total of 247 studio, one, two, and three-bedroom apartments across three blocks.
Our team have been overcoming the logistical challenges of building next to the canal and working in close proximity to the railway station both of which you can see in the drone footage above.
